Disregarding Safety Measures



Neglecting safety and security precautions throughout roofing cleansing can cause serious accidents or injuries. You could feel great going up there, yet the threats are real. Always put on proper safety gear, consisting of non-slip footwear, handwear covers, and goggles. These easy items can make a significant distinction in your safety and security.

Making use of a durable ladder is important. Make sure it's positioned on a level surface area and that someone exists to hold it stable while you function. If you're dealing with a high roofing system, think about making use of a harness and rope for added security. Don't take unnecessary dangers; if the problems are wet or gusty, it's best to postpone your cleansing.

Also, recognize your environments. Look out for power lines or looming branches that could present a threat. If you're using a pressure washing machine, maintain a secure range from the edge of the roofing system to stop sliding or shedding your balance.

Taking these preventative measures isn't just about safeguarding on your own; it's likewise about making certain that your roof covering stays in good condition. By prioritizing security, you'll make your roofing cleaning experience more efficient and much less unsafe.

Skipping Normal Maintenance



Regular upkeep is necessary for keeping your roofing in top form, as neglecting it can result in significant troubles down the line. You could assume that avoiding maintenance is a means to conserve money and time, but in reality, it can cost you far more in repairs later on.

Consistently checking your roof covering aids you identify issues like missing out on tiles, leakages, or particles build-up prior to they rise right into major damage.



To stay clear of the blunder of missing maintenance, set a timetable for routine examinations and cleanings. Go for at the very least two times a year, ideally in spring and loss, when weather conditions are moderate. During these inspections, search for indications of damage, such as cracked or curling shingles, moss growth, or clogged rain gutters.

Don't neglect to examine the flashing around smokeshafts and vents, as these areas can be susceptible to leaks.

If you're unclear concerning performing maintenance yourself, consider working with an expert. Buying routine maintenance not just prolongs your roof's lifespan but also safeguards your home from costly repairs.
